How much do full time xbox game tester jobs pay per hour?

As of Sep 5, 2026, the average hourly pay for full time xbox game tester in the United States is $18.29,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$16.35 and $19.95 per hour, depending on experience, location, and employer.

How to become a full time Xbox game tester?

To become a full-time Xbox game tester, candidates typically need a strong passion for gaming, good communication skills, and knowledge of gaming platforms. Relevant experience can include testing games, familiarity with bug tracking tools, and understanding of game development processes. Many positions require a high school diploma or equivalent, and some companies prefer candidates with prior testing or quality assurance experience.

Is a full time Xbox game tester a legit job?

A full-time Xbox game tester is a legitimate role in the gaming industry, involving playing and evaluating video games to identify bugs and improve quality. It typically requires attention to detail, knowledge of gaming systems, and sometimes specific certifications or experience, with schedules often including regular working hours. However, job seekers should be cautious of scams and verify the employer's credibility before applying.

JOB SUMMARY:

This is an entry level position that provides service to internal and external guest while ensuring gaming devices receive maintenance, repairs, perform projects, and test gaming equipment in a timely manner to ensure maximum opportunity of availability.

JOB ESSENTIAL DUTIES AND RESPONSIBILITIES:

  • Endorse the business objectives, ethics, and values of Caesars Entertainment in accordance with the Code of Commitment and Mission, Vision and Values
  • Conduct preventative maintenance on gaming devices
  • Maintain a sense of urgency in responding to calls over the radio
  • Take initiative to provide internal and external service to guest, coworkers and supervisors
  • Conduct manufacturers I/O tests
  • Observe repairs conducted by higher Level Game Technicians
  • Invoke service recovery
  • Perform ticket in/out, and multi-denomination testing on gaming devices in accordance with internal controls
  • Translate and explain game recall, pay tables and logs
  • Isolate and diagnose repairs on gaming devices, sub-component, and related equipment
  • Install, convert and move gaming devices
  • Posses the ability to work in a individual, or team environment
  • Maintain technical brand certification (yearly)
  • Demonstrate high levels of required service skills on a consistent basis
  • Delight our guests with outstanding service
  • Adhere to regulatory, departmental, and company policies/procedures in an ethical manner
